Carlyle seeks to hire a Product Specialist in our Global Private Equity Investor Relations Group, based in London. The Product Specialist will be responsible for product coverage of Carlyle's European Private Equity strategy, including Carlyle Europe Partners and Carlyle Europe Technology Partners. Responsibilities include supporting fundraising processes, product and strategy development, and handling investor requests. The candidate should be able to prioritize tasks and work efficiently under pressure in a deadline-driven environment.

Responsibilities:

  • Serve as a subject matter expert on European private equity strategies
  • Maintain fund and portfolio level talking points
  • Conduct market research and benchmark performance
  • Prepare presentations and content for investor meetings and conferences
  • Build and maintain relationships with Investment Teams, Sales, Fund Management, Legal, and Compliance
  • Manage information flow during fundraising
  • Assist in pre-marketing, strategy, and product development for new funds
  • Update marketing and due diligence materials
  • Oversee datarooms and access monitoring
  • Maintain fundraising pipelines
  • Respond to investor diligence requests
  • Coordinate roadshows, meetings, and due diligence sessions

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ree required
  • 1-3 years of relevant experience
  • Strong organizational and project management skills
  • Team player with solutions-oriented mindset
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ively
  • Capable of multitasking, prioritizing, and meeting deadlines
  • Proactive, organized, detail-oriented
  • Excellent interpersonal, communication, and writing skills
  • Data manipulation skills to support analysis
  • Familiarity with CRM systems and reporting
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int, Word)

Company Profile:

The Carlyle Group (NASDAQ: CG) is a global investment firm managing $441 billion of assets across various sectors and regions. Founded in 1987, Carlyle employs over 2,300 professionals worldwide and emphasizes diversity, development, and inclusion. The firm's investment segments include Private Equity, Credit, and Investment Solutions, with expertise across multiple industries.
